Four MDA Mentor-Protégé Teams Win Nunn-Perry Award

15-NEWS-0002
February 9, 2015

The Missile Defense Agency (MDA) announced today that four teams supporting MDA under the auspices of the Department of Defense (DoD) Mentor-Protégé Program will receive the prestigious Nunn-Perry Award. The award, named in honor of former Senator Sam Nunn and former Secretary of Defense William Perry, was first awarded in 1995 and recognizes mentor-protégé teams that have excelled in technical developments, cost effectiveness and increased business opportunities for small disadvantaged firms.

The following mentor-protégé teams were four out of 14 award winners for 2014 announced by the DoD’s Office of Small Business Programs. The recipients are the teams of The Boeing Company of Huntsville, Alabama, and Victory Solutions Inc. of Huntsville, Alabama; Lockheed Martin Space Systems Company of Huntsville, Alabama, and IERUS Technologies Inc. of Huntsville, Alabama; Raytheon Missile Systems of Tucson, Arizona, and Advanced Powder Solutions Inc. of Cypress, Texas; and Tec-Masters Inc. of Huntsville, Alabama, and ProjectXYZ of Huntsville, Alabama.

The DoD Mentor-Protégé Program assists small businesses to successfully compete for prime contract and subcontract awards by partnering them with large companies under individual, project-based agreements. Successful mentor-protégé agreements provide a winning relationship for the protégé, the mentor, and the DoD.

“The DoD Mentor-Protégé Program benefits MDA by fostering lasting partnerships between large business prime contractors who support the agency and small innovative businesses that have capabilities we can use,” said Lee Rosenberg, director of the MDA Office of Small Business Programs.

“The idea is to improve the quality and cost of the products and services we deliver to the warfighter by tapping into the innovation and flexibility of the small business community while we help them grow their capabilities,” said Rosenberg.

The winning teams will receive the award at the Nunn-Perry Awards Ceremony March 12 at the Mark Center in Alexandria, Virginia.
